You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: README.md
+4-4Lines changed: 4 additions & 4 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-314,8 +314,8 @@ The HTML output accepts a Javascript object with configuration. Possible options
314
314
315
315
-`outputFormat`: the format of the output data: `'line-by-line'` or `'side-by-side'`, default is `'line-by-line'`
316
316
-`drawFileList`: show a file list before the diff: `true` or `false`, default is `true`
317
-
-`srcPrefix`: add a prefix to all source (before changes) filepaths, default is `''`
318
-
-`dstPrefix`: add a prefix to all destination (after changes) filepaths, default is `''`
317
+
-`srcPrefix`: add a prefix to all source (before changes) filepaths, default is `''`. Should match the prefix used when [generating the diff](https://git-scm.com/docs/git-diff#Documentation/git-diff.txt---src-prefixltprefixgt).
318
+
-`dstPrefix`: add a prefix to all destination (after changes) filepaths, default is `''`. Should match the prefix used when [generating the diff](https://git-scm.com/docs/git-diff#Documentation/git-diff.txt---dst-prefixltprefixgt)
319
319
-`diffMaxChanges`: number of changed lines after which a file diff is deemed as too big and not displayed, default is
320
320
`undefined`
321
321
-`diffMaxLineLength`: number of characters in a diff line after which a file diff is deemed as too big and not
@@ -333,8 +333,8 @@ The HTML output accepts a Javascript object with configuration. Possible options
333
333
`2500`
334
334
-`maxLineSizeInBlockForComparison`: maximum number os characters of the bigger line in a block to apply comparison,
335
335
default is `200`
336
-
-`compiledTemplates`: object (Hogan template values) with previously compiled templates to replace parts of the html,
337
-
default is`{}`
336
+
-`compiledTemplates`: object ([Hogan.js](https://github.com/twitter/hogan.js/) template values) with previously compiled templates to replace parts of the html, default is `{}`.
337
+
For example:`{ "tag-file-changed": Hogan.compile("<span class="d2h-tag d2h-changed d2h-changed-tag">MODIFIED</span>") }`
338
338
-`rawTemplates`: object (string values) with raw not compiled templates to replace parts of the html, default is `{}`.
339
339
For example: `{ "tag-file-changed": "<span class="d2h-tag d2h-changed d2h-changed-tag">MODIFIED</span>" }`
340
340
> For more information regarding the possible templates look into
0 commit comments